    CVE-2017-5241

    Biscom Secure File Transfer versions 5.0.0.0 trough 5.1.1024 are vulnerable to post-authentication persistent cross-site scripting (XSS) in the "Name" and "Description" fields of a Workspace, as well as the "Description" field of a File Details pane of a file stored in a Workspace. This issue has been resolved in version 5.1.1025.
